Background
Born in Kadıköy, Istanbul on January 23, 1994, Büşra Ahlatcı began playing football in her early years with the support of her father.

Club
She obtained her license on November 1, 2007. In the 2008-2009 season, she joined the high school team Ümraniye Mevlana Lisesi Spor, which competed in the Women"s Second League. Already the next season, she found a place in the Ataşehir Belediyespor squad playing in the First League.
Ahlatcı enjoyed two league championship titles with her club in two consecutive seasons, in 2010-2011 and 2011-2012.
She debuted in the Union of European Football Associations Women"s Champions League playing in qualification round match against Gintra-Universitetas from Lithuania on August 11, 2011. She took part in two following matches of her club at the 2011-2012 Union of European Football Associations Women"s Champions League - Group 4 round.

Ahlatcı was admitted to the Turkey women"s U-19 national team in 2011.
She played her first match against Ukrainian juniors at the Kuban Spring Tournament on March 6, 2011.
She capped 12 times for the U-19 nationals. She was called up to the Turkey women"s national team, and debuted in the Union of European Football Associations Women"s Euro 2013 qualifying – Group 2 match against the Swiss team on September 15, 2012. She took part in only two games of the tournament"s ten matches of her country.
She capped twice so far for the Turkey national team
She is member of the Turkey women"s national team since 2012.
